The planting session, organized by the CODRU Festival team, will take place on the weekend of May 6-7 in the Două Dealuri area, Recaș. We remind you that for two days, between 10:00 am and 6:00 pm, participants will carry out planting actions hourly in groups of up to 50 people. The organizers provide the necessary tools. A relaxation area will also be set up, where those involved in the planting process will enjoy live music, DJs, food & drinks until 8:00 pm.

Participation is free and is based on completing a form by accessing the official website codrufestival.ro.

The Nomad Dance project aims to bring contemporary dance closer to the residents of Timișoara neighborhoods, through choreographic moments taking place in various public spaces: Dacia Park (May 22, 5:30 pm), Lidia Park (May 23, 5:30 pm), Traian Square (May 24, 5:30 pm), and Uzinei Park (May 25, 5:30 pm).

In 2023, the project continues to develop its relationship with the communities in Timiș County by organizing theater, dance, and film workshops for children and teenagers in Lugoj (May 8-11), Jimbolia (May 12-15), and Dumbrăvița (May 18-21). The results of the projects will be presented between May 26 and June 3, 2023, in Timișoara, through a dance performance, "DansNomad Introspective", on May 26 (Maria Theresia Bastion) and a video exhibition "DansNomad Retrospective", from May 27 to June 3, at the National Museum of Banat.

The Art Encounters Foundation has prepared an intense and attractive program for the opening weekend of the fifth edition of the Art Encounters Biennale - My Rhino Is Not a Myth art science fictions, sprinkled with various activities such as guided tours with invited artists and the curator of the biennale, conferences, immersive experiences, performances and concerts, tours with a tram populated by the famous work of artist Carlos Amorales - Black Cloud, a picnic & informal discussions with artists, as well as the launch of the Art Encounters Biennale Catalog at the "La Două Bufnițe" bookstore. This event will occur from May 19 to 21 at the Isho Complex.

The Art Encounters Biennale: My Rhino is Not a Myth. art science fictions will span eight weeks, between May 19 and July 16, and will produce ten new works, artistic interventions in public spaces, and interdisciplinary events.

Between May 30 and June 3, the Institute of the Present is organizing a series of workshops for schoolchildren aged 8 to 12, led by choreographer Mădălina Dan, based on the installation „Eu și linia”. The challenge of the workshop Te afli aici: Eu și linia is to build the „Eu și linia” installation using simple elements and tools based on given instructions. Workshop participants will experience how movement can generate meaning in action and visual representation.
